Output 218559dae39ea66798818281a1c088ef5aa6865f69fbb1f23d35c8d8dccfaf62:2

value
5855200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e68c29caf9dc9898032a8bdb81eff074a9b7b61c OP_EQUALVERIFY OP_CHECKSIG
address
n2XyctVVSEfm27QWUeZu9Dw77i8pcnvaKD
transaction
218559dae39ea66798818281a1c088ef5aa6865f69fbb1f23d35c8d8dccfaf62
confirmations
50644
spent
true